TrueDelta Reviews the Real Gas Mileage of the Fiat 500L

Fiat 500L Real Gas Mileage: Pros
YearComment
2014 The FIAT 500L's EPA ratings--24 mpg city, 33 mpg highway--are about as good as you'll see in a small, conventionally propelled crossover. The Buick Encore does a touch better (25/33), but the MINI doesn't (23/30), and the Kia Soul scores considerably worse, at least on the highway (23/28). In real-world driving the 500L's trip computer reported averages around 30 in the suburbs (even 37 with a very light right foot) and about 35 on a 70-mph highway. Two caveats. Make a lot of use of the turbo, and fuel economy will plummet. And while premium fuel is not required, it is recommended. see full Fiat 500L review
 

What Our Members Are Saying about the Real Gas Mileage of the Fiat 500L

Fiat 500L Real Gas Mileage: Cons
YearBody/PowertrainComment
2014 4dr Hatch turbocharged 160hp 1.4L I4
6-speed automated manual FWD
The gas mileage is nothing to write home about, but it's nothing to scream and shout about either. It's about average for this size of car. I'm seeing the upper 20s so far in a mix of city and highway driving. Fiat recommends premium unleaded, but it does run fine on regular unleaded. see full Fiat 500L review
